Biographical Note

Allison Wolfe was born in Memphis Tennessee in 1969 and grew up in an all-female household. Her mother, a lesbian feminist, started the first women's health clinic in Olympia, Washington. Wolfe is a songwriter and arts journalist who co-founded the third wave feminist punk movement, Riot Grrrl. She also co-founded the feminist punk fanzine, "Girl Germs," and sang in several bands throughout the 1990s and 2000s including Bratmobile, Cold Cold Hearts, Deep Lust, Partyline, Cool Moms, and Sex Stains. In 1999 she organized Ladyfest, a non-profit feminist music festival. Wolfe received a master's degree in arts journalism from the University of Southern California's Annenberg School for Communication and Journalism.

Scope and Contents

This collection consists of two dresses, three "performance slips," and one pair of shoes. Wolfe wore the slips during the 1990s while performing with the band, Bratmobile. The dresses and shoes are consistent with the style of clothing women wore in the 1990s and early 2000s, which is associated with the third wave feminist punk movement.

Processing Information

The garments were housed in a 16.5" x 20.5" x 3" box. Unbuffered tissue was folded with each garment and the garments were placed on pieces of blue board for support. The shoes were placed in a box with unbuffered tissue for support.
